This started out as an experiment I wasn't really expecting much out of, but I ended up liking it enough to post it here.

I used a vintage photograph as reference for the pose, and as it's mainly an experiment with technique there isn't much more behind this image. However, I find she closely resembles an idea I had in mind for a painting I want to do of the Slavic goddess of spring, Vesna (using my good friend Vesna as model, of course ;)).

My paternal grandfather is Serbian and I've taken part in his customs and traditions growing up. It's a part of my heritage I'm interested in exploring further through my art.

Watercolour and various inks (white, mostly... still in love with that) on watercolour paper. 19x15 inches.
